rust辅助重启、rust顽皮兔辅助
·2023/05/23 06:10 浏览次数: TGA: rust辅助重启
Rust辅助重启简介
Rust是一种系统编程语言,它提供了内存安全和高性能。在开发中,Rust有一个重要的优势,即可以保持程序的稳定性。即使程序被意外杀死,开发人员可以使用Rust辅助重启快速恢复程序。在本文中,我们将重点介绍Rust辅助重启,并介绍它的优点。
为什么需要辅助重启?
在现代操作系统中,有时会发生应用程序崩溃或意外中断的情况。如果您的应用程序在这些情况下继续运行,它可能会出现问题,甚至可能对系统造成影响。辅助重启可以帮助您快速恢复应用程序,并确保您的程序持续运行。
如何实现Rust辅助重启?
为了实现Rust辅助重启,我们需要使用一个叫做systemd的工具。systemd是Linux的一个init系统和系统管理器。您可以使用systemd来创建一个称为服务单元的配置文件。在服务单元中,您可以为您的应用程序指定重启策略和重启次数。
要使用systemd,您需要创建一个服务单元文件。该文件包含有关您的应用程序的信息,例如如何启动和停止应用程序,以及如何重启应用程序。一旦您的服务单元文件准备就绪,您可以使用systemd来管理您的应用程序。
当您的应用程序崩溃时,systemd将自动重启它。如果您的应用程序在指定的次数内继续失败,则systemd将停止尝试重启应用程序。这可以帮助您确保您的应用程序在最短时间内恢复,同时最大限度地减少可能发生的影响。